A Brief History of Roulette
The game of roulette originated in 18th-century France as a luxury attraction for wealthy casino powerplay nobles. Over time, it spread to casinos across Europe and eventually around the globe. The basic principles remain unchanged: players place bets on either red or black, odd or even, or specific numbers. A croupier spins the wheel, releasing the ball, which lands in one of 37 (European) or 38 (American) numbered pockets.
How Online Casino Roulette Works
Online casino roulette is a digital adaptation of its traditional counterpart. Players access games through their web browser or download dedicated software from online casinos. The interface typically consists of:
- Roulette wheel : A virtual representation of the physical game, featuring numbered and colored sections.
- Bet table : Where players place wagers on various outcomes.
- Chip tray : For managing digital chips used to bet.
Gameplay occurs as follows: a player selects their bets, places them at the designated areas, and waits for the croupier (software-controlled in online versions) to spin the wheel. Once the ball lands, winning or losing outcomes are automatically determined based on bet positions.
Types of Online Casino Roulette Games
Several variations of roulette exist:
- European Roulette : Features 37 numbered pockets with one zero.
- American Roulette : Boasts an additional double-zero (00) pocket for more house edge-friendly rules.
- French Roulette : Includes some European Roulette features and uses a unique betting system, La Partage or En Prison.
- Live Dealer Roulette : Offers a hybrid experience with real dealers in virtual settings.
